Review: Jayne Denham Turns Up the Heat on “Hillbilly Halo”

There’s a fine line between country-rock and arena rock, and Jayne Denham doesn’t just walk it on “Hillbilly Halo,” she barrels straight through it. Produced by Marti Frederiksen, whose credits span Aerosmith, Carrie Underwood, Def Leppard, and Sheryl Crow, “Hillbilly Halo” is unapologetically big. The guitars hit hard, the production leans stadium-ready, and the energy never lets up.
